Title :
Detection of road surface conditions by using an omni-directional camera and polarization properties

Abstract :
In this paper, we propose a new method for detecting hazardous road surface conditions by using an omni-directional camera. A special imaging device that combines an omni-directional camera and a new detection method which uses polarization properties has been created for achieving good performance. By using this method, we can significantly reduce the number of traffic cameras for video surveillance used in the present.
